Patch Grants support young builders in Ireland (ages 13–19) with quick, flexible funding to help them take action.

Whether you want to:

  • Build a prototype or hardware project
  • Run a small community event or workshop
  • Travel to a conference or learning opportunity
  • Explore an idea you can't shake

…we'll fund anything that meaningfully helps you learn by doing.

Grant size €200–€1,000
Turnaround ~1 week
Process Short form → 15–30 min call → decision

These grants are designed to help people get started fast — before they have a network, track record, or budget. Even small projects can unlock confidence, skills, and momentum that carry forward into much bigger things.

FAQs

Who can apply for a grant?

Young people aged 13–19 in Ireland who want to build, create, or make something happen.

What can I apply with?

Anything that helps you learn, build, and push yourself. We fund hardware & engineering projects, community events & workshops, travel for learning, creative technical projects, and early-stage experiments. You do not need a polished idea — curiosity + action count.

How much funding can I get?

€200–€1,000. If your project needs more, we'll help you think through other funding options.

What's the process?

Fast and lightweight: 1. Short online form → 2. 15–30 min call → 3. Decision within ~1 week.

Do I get mentorship?

Yes. We connect you with someone helpful in your domain when relevant. Mentorship is tailored and lightweight — these grants are about momentum, not bureaucracy.

What do you look for?

Curiosity and initiative. A desire to learn by doing. Follow-through. Ambition to stretch yourself.

Can I reapply?

Yes! If your idea evolves or you have a new one, you're welcome to apply again.
